Our prestigious and fully accredited MSc program will provide you with outstanding analytical and technical expertise in various civil engineering specialties, preparing you for a thriving career in this sector. Delivered by research-focused faculty alongside practicing engineers from consulting firms and government agencies, this program offers an ideal blend of academic theory and practical industry knowledge. The curriculum is carefully designed to align with the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als, with particular focus on sustainable and resilient civil infrastructure design. Our accredited master's program enables you to develop specialized skills and comprehensive understanding in key civil engineering areas such as structural engineering, infrastructure systems, geotechnics, and water/environmental engineering, allowing you to customize your graduate studies to match your professional ambitions.

Qualification Requirements

A minimum of a 2:2 UK honours degree in civil engineering (or mechanical engineering, architecture, land surveying or other related subjects), or equivalent recognised international degree. IELTS Academic: 6.5 overall with 6.0 in Writing and 5.5 in each other element. TOEFL (ibt) - 88 overall with 12 in Reading, 11 in Listening, 17 in Speaking and 23 in Writing.
